3. Native options
Native options play a pivotal position in facilitating location sharing between iOS and Android ecosystems. These functionalities, built-in straight into the working techniques, supply a streamlined and infrequently safer technique of transmitting positional knowledge throughout platforms. Their significance lies in offering accessible instruments with out necessitating reliance on third-party purposes.
-
Apple’s Discover My App
Apple’s Discover My app, whereas primarily designed for finding misplaced or stolen gadgets, additionally permits location sharing with designated contacts. An iPhone consumer can share their location with an Android consumer by inviting them by way of the Discover My app. The Android consumer receives a hyperlink that opens in an online browser, displaying the iPhone consumer’s location. This implementation leverages a web-based interface to beat platform incompatibility.
-
Google’s Location Sharing
Google provides built-in location sharing capabilities inside its Google Maps utility. An Android consumer can share their real-time location with an iPhone consumer straight by way of the app. The iPhone consumer receives the shared location inside Google Maps on their machine. This cross-platform performance underscores Google’s give attention to interoperability inside its companies. The placement sharing will be set for a particular length or till manually disabled.

-
Encryption Protocols
Encryption protocols kind the cornerstone of knowledge safety in location sharing. Finish-to-end encryption, for instance, ensures that location knowledge is scrambled into an unreadable format from the purpose of origin (the consumer’s machine) till it reaches the supposed recipient’s machine. Interception of the info throughout transit would yield solely unintelligible characters, rendering it ineffective to unauthorized events. Safe Sockets Layer (SSL) and Transport Layer Safety (TLS) are generally employed to encrypt communication channels between gadgets and servers, stopping eavesdropping and man-in-the-middle assaults. With out strong encryption, location knowledge can be vulnerable to interception and misuse, undermining all the system’s safety.

Query 6: Are there limitations on the accuracy of location knowledge shared between iPhones and Androids?
Location accuracy will be affected by components similar to GPS sign energy, Wi-Fi availability, and mobile community protection. Discrepancies in accuracy could come up between gadgets on account of variations in {hardware} and software program implementations. Location knowledge accessed by way of an online browser may expertise diminished accuracy in comparison with knowledge accessed by way of a local utility.

Important Steerage for Cross-Platform Location Sharing
Successfully leveraging cross-platform location sharing calls for cautious consideration of technical and safety components. The next suggestions present important steerage for customers searching for to transmit location knowledge between iOS and Android gadgets.
Tip 1: Choose a Respected Software: Prioritize purposes with established monitor data and clear privateness insurance policies. Examine consumer critiques and safety assessments earlier than entrusting location knowledge to a third-party supplier. The applying ought to make use of strong encryption and cling to knowledge safety requirements.
Tip 2: Evaluate Privateness Settings: Scrutinize the privateness settings inside the chosen utility and working system. Configure settings to limit entry to location knowledge to approved people and for specified durations. Often overview and modify these settings to align with evolving privateness preferences.
Tip 3: Allow Location Providers: Be sure that location companies are enabled on each gadgets. With out energetic location companies, the transmission and reception of location knowledge will likely be impaired. Confirm that the appliance has the required permissions to entry location data.
Tip 4: Check Connectivity: Verify that each gadgets possess steady web connections (Wi-Fi or mobile knowledge). Unreliable connectivity can disrupt the transmission of location knowledge and result in inaccurate or delayed updates. Take into account testing the connection in a identified location earlier than counting on location sharing in important conditions.
Tip 5: Calibrate Location Accuracy: Perceive the restrictions of location accuracy. Components similar to GPS sign energy, Wi-Fi availability, and environmental situations can have an effect on the precision of location knowledge. Bear in mind that shared places could not at all times mirror the precise place of the machine.
Tip 6: Be Conscious of Battery Consumption: Acknowledge that steady location monitoring can considerably influence battery life. Disable location sharing when it isn’t actively required to preserve battery energy. Think about using power-saving modes to mitigate battery drain.
